In the Fight of Hastings, William's army defeated their rival, King Harold Godwin, who was killed during the engagement. William could then assert the throne as Harold was elected instead of a true member on the royal spouse and children. Despite the results in the foreign conquest, English nobles have been permitted to retain their land Except they rebelled.
Any resisting English elite experienced their lands confiscated, and some of them fled into exile Subsequently. William granted lands to his followers and built commanding armed service strongpoint castles for defence of his realm.[11]

Latin, for a language employed by the educated, along with the language of the Anglo-Saxons each had a profound impact on the spelling and pronunciation of Norman names in Britain. Alternatively, the Norman language impacted the development of English. As being the English language created from its Germanic roots into Center English (which was affected by Norman French) we discover a interval throughout which spelling was not standardised but about adopted phonetic pronunciation. During this time names had been spelled a range of ways depending on nearby dialects. As a result the surname, together with the Anglo-Saxon names, have been recorded in a number of techniques.[ten]

Jacques is in the Latin name Jacobus. This is a masculine title Which means "supplanter" or "just one who follows". It is usually related to the Hebrew name Yaakov, which suggests "he who supplants".[2]
